What is this event?

This is a game jam being hosted by Arctic Game at Umeå University. A game jam is like game development speedrunning event; people of all experience levels (yes even newcomers)  form small groups to make a game in a short period of time. Game Jams provide the perfect territory for testing fun new ideas, meeting new people, and building on/ trying out new skills!

Why an extension?

To keep the ball rolling & give your 

game ideas a proper chance to shine! 

Game Jams go by so fast & with such intensity that it's often difficult to keep things going afterwards. Many brilliant ideas get abandoned and are forever related to existing on a single hard drive in an unfortunately buggy state. We want to give you all a chance to refine them so they can be played by more people & potentially grow to become bigger projects!

Voting Process

For this game jam, we're opening up the voting for public voting! Anyone is welcome to come and play! It's expected that the bulk of players will come from the network of us & the jammers, so...

Share! Share! Share!

To keep things as fair as possible, we are also using the recommended rating queue system to minimise cheating, or keep a team with a big social media following from having an advantage. This means you'll have to play 5 games minimum before your rankings are counted.
